Many of castor oil’s benefits come down to its chemical composition. It’s classified as atype oftriglyceride fatty acid, and almost 90 percent of its fatty acid content is a specific and rare compound called ricinoleic acid. Castor oil is considered to be pretty unique because ricinoleic acid is not found in many other substances, plus it’s such adense, concentrated source. It is produced by cold-pressing the castor bean seeds to extract their natural oil content.
